After being Sky customers for many years, we upgraded to Sky Q. Everything seemed fine at first, but over the next week we had worsening problems with the mini box not connecting to the main box, and the mini box remote not working. We were also repeatedly losing internet on all our other devices, and suffering loss of connection between devices, where we had never had problems before. Things seemed to get worse as the days went by. My husband works in IT, and he spent many hours trying to solve the problems, but couldn't. We looked on the Sky help forums, and there were loads of other people all experiencing exactly the same problems as us with Sky Q. It seems to be a design fault with the equipment, not only does it not work properly, but it floods your home network with data, and causes problems with all your other devices. All the problems go away as soon as the Sky Q boxes are unplugged. We definitely would not recommend Sky Q!
